FAZIA is designed for detailed studies of the isospin degree of freedom, extending to the limits the isotopic identi-cation of charged products from nuclear collisions when using silicon detectors and CsI(Tl) scintillators. We show that the FAZIA telescopes give isotopic identi-cation up to Z- around 25 with a -E-E technique. Digital Pulse Shape Analysis makes possible elemental identi-cation up to Z=55 and isotopic identi-cation for Z=1-10 when using the response of a single silicon detector. The project is now in the phase of building a demonstrator comprising about 200 telescopes.
